Snow Bunny's Story

Location: Dayton, OH<br/><br/>Food: American Journey Venison and Sweet Potato<br/><br/>Medication: NexGard Plus<br/><br/>Bunny is a 4-year-old French Bulldog who is officially clocking out of her former life as a working momma and clocking in to her new role: full-time, highly committed, slightly dramatic, deeply devoted love bug.<br/><br/>Let me explain...<br/><br/>Bunny doesn't just love-she LOVES.<br/>Capital letters. Whole heart. No chill.<br/><br/>She is the kind of dog who will follow you from room to room like it's her full-time job (because, in her mind, it is). Sit down? She's in your lap. Move? She's right behind you. Make eye contact? Congratulations, you've just been chosen as her entire world.<br/><br/>And when she's happy-which is often-she celebrates with the most chaotic, joyful zoomies like she just won the lottery... even after everything she's been through.<br/><br/>Because Bunny has been through it.<br/><br/>After an IVDD episode that required four months of crate rest (yes, four... months... for a dog with this much personality), she came out the other side still soft, still loving, still ready to give her whole heart away. She's since had PDLA surgery to help prevent future issues, and she's expected to go on living a happy, normal, zoomie-filled life.<br/><br/>And somehow, through all of that... she didn't harden.<br/>She didn't shut down.<br/>She just decided to love harder.<br/><br/>Bunny is listed as an only dog-not because she's done anything wrong-but because she feels things big. Other dogs can make her anxious, and truthfully? She doesn't need them. She wants her person. Her couch. Her spotlight. Her little world where she can love without hesitation.<br/><br/>And when she feels safe? When she trusts you?<br/><br/>You will have a dog who looks at you like you hung the moon.<br/>A shadow with a heartbeat.<br/>A best friend who would choose you, every single time.<br/><br/>Bunny does best with someone who understands bulldogs-their quirks, their sensitivity, their need for loving but confident guidance. Give her that structure, and she will give you everything she has.<br/><br/>And what she has... is a lot of love.<br/><br/>The kind that's a little funny.<br/>A little intense.<br/>A little clingy.<br/>And completely, unapologetically, beautifully hers.<br/><br/><br/>***Adoption Process***<br/>-All current pets in the home need to be spayed/neutered, up to date on vaccines and on veterinarian prescribed flea/tick/heart worm prevention.<br/>-Everyone living in the home, including all resident dogs, must be present at the meet and greet located in the Southwest Ohio area.<br/>-We DO NOT ship dogs!!!

Badass Bulldog Rescue, Inc.'s Adoption Policy
All potential adopters must complete an application for each pup they are interested in. (The link is located at the bottom of the bio on PetFinder.) Adopters are required to complete the application in full. Failure to be thorough will result in denial. Adopters are required to have ALL pets up-to-date on vaccinations, spayed/neutered, and on heartworm/flea preventative. We conduct vet checks, phone screens, meet and greets, and a home visit for the final step. All steps are completed in this order.
